Imperfect fabric Bamboo green. Imperfection: green spot. Size: 2.9 x1.50 meters Fabric: cotton indoors. Hand painted fabrics Made in Capri from the 60s.
Imperfect fabric Bamboo green. Imperfection: green spot. Size: 2.9 x1.50 meters Fabric: cotton indoors. Hand painted fabrics Made in Capri from the 60s.